README
⛵ yahttp - Awesome simple HTTP client for Nim
- Based on Nim std/httpclient
- No additional dependencies
- API focused on DX
Installation
nimble install yahttp
Examples
more examples here
Get HTTP status code
import yahttp
echo get("https://www.google.com/").status
Send query params and parse response to JSON
import json
import yahttp
let laptopsJson = get("https://dummyjson.com/products/search", query = {"q": "Laptop"}).json()
echo laptopsJson["products"][0]["title"].getStr()
API
Method procedures
get("http://api")
put("http://api")
post("http://api")
patch("http://api")
delete("http://api")
head("http://api")
options("http://api")
Arguments:
- url - request URL. The only required argument
- headers - request HTTP headers. Example: {"header1": "val", "header2": "val2"}
- query - request query params. Example: {"param1": "val", "param2": "val2"}
- encodeQueryParams - parameters for encodeQuery function that encodes query params. More
- body - request body as a string. Example: "{\"key\": \"value\"}". Is not available for get, head and options procedures
- files - array of files to upload. Every file is a tuple of multipart name, file name, content type and content
- sreamingFiles - array of files to stream from disc and upload. Every file is a tuple of multipart name and file path
- auth - login and password for basic authorization. Example: ("login", "password")
- timeout - stop waiting for a response after a given number of milliseconds. -1 for no timeout, which is default value
- ignoreSsl - no certificate verification if true
- sslContext - SSL context for TLS/SSL connections. See newContext
General procedure
request("http://api")
Has the same arguments as method procedures and one additional:
- httpMethod - HTTP method. Method.GET by default. Example: Method.POST
Response object
All procedures above return Response object with fields:
- status - HTTP status code
- body - response body as a string
- headers - table, where keys are header keys and values are sequences of header values for a key
- request - object with request data processed by yahttp
- url - stores full url with query params
- headers - stores HTTP headers with Authorization for basic authorization
- httpMethod - HTTP method
- body - request body as a string
Response object has some helper procedures:
- Response.json() - returns response body as JSON
- Response.html() - returns response body as HTML
- Response.to(t) - converts response body to JSON and unmarshals it to type t
- Response.ok() - returns true if status is greater than 0 and less than 400
- Response.raiseForStatus() - throws HttpError exceptions if status is 400 or above
Other helper functions
object.toJsonString() - converts object of any type to json string. Helpful to use for body argument
